FENDI has always operated in a space where luxury feels composed rather than declared. The Maison’s strongest pieces are never loud; they rely on proportion, material intelligence and an understanding of how fashion lives beyond a single season.
This personal edit brings together my current FENDI favourites — pieces that feel considered, wearable and quietly authoritative. Nothing here is trend-led. Each item earns its place through balance and restraint.
The cropped knit top is a study in subtle femininity. Soft in texture, precise in cut, it works effortlessly with tailoring or relaxed silhouettes. It is the kind of piece that integrates rather than competes.
The FF-jacquard trousers translate heritage into something modern and understated. The pattern is present but controlled — woven into the fabric rather than applied as a statement. This is where FENDI’s craftsmanship becomes most apparent.
Footwear and accessories reveal the Maison’s design intelligence at its clearest. The Baguette loafer balances structure with lightness, while the Peekaboo bag remains one of the most enduring luxury designs of the last decades — architectural, functional and unmistakably FENDI without excess.
Even the smallest details matter. The compact logo earrings act as punctuation rather than proclamation. They sit close to the skin, confident but never performative.
This edit reflects how FENDI works best: when luxury is expressed through clarity. Through materials that age well, shapes that endure, and pieces designed to live within real wardrobes.
